TJL Notifies Google Leadership of Google’s Potential Liability for Facilitating Genocide, War Crimes, and Crimes Against Humanity in Gaza

Tech Justice Law, the Abolitionist Law Center, and the Center for Constitutional Rights sent a letter notifying Google and its executive leadership of its potential liability for aiding and abetting atrocity crimes committed by Israel against the Palestinian population of Gaza. Israel’s military assault on Gaza over the last 2.5 years has been called the world’s first “AI-powered genocide.” As the letter explains, Google is one of two companies selling the Israeli government cloud computing and AI services under a contractual framework called Project Nimbus, which has provided technical infrastructure used to commit the gravest of atrocities in Gaza.

“Google has repeatedly chosen profit over Palestinian lives, continuing to assist Israel under Project Nimbus even as Israeli officials openly acknowledged that Nimbus was essential to powering their assault on Gaza,” said Madeline Batt, Legal Fellow at Tech Justice Law. “Google must abide by its obligations under international and domestic law.”
